Honeywell Surface Mount Differential Pressure Sensor, -5 to 5psi, 3.3V DC - ABP Series - ABPMRRN005PD2A3
Measure the difference between two pressures with this differential pressure sensor from Honeywell. It's suitable for surface mounting for ease of installation. It has a low supply voltage of just 3.3V DC, making it suitable for use in low-voltage applications. It has a wide operating pressure range of -5 to 5psi, so it's suitable for use in low to medium-pressure environments.
Features & Benefits
• Internal diagnostics to ensure higher accuracy
• Six-pin design makes it easy to mount onto a printed circuit board
• Fast startup time of just 5ms for rapid operation

How does a piezoresistive silicon pressure sensor work?
A piezoresistive silicon pressure sensor like this one uses changes in electrical resistance to measure corresponding changes in pressure.
